Is this part of a long-running horror franchise?
Yes! Honto ni Atta Kowai Hanashi — which translates roughly as "Really Scary True Stories" — has been a beloved fixture of Japanese television since the 1990s. The summer specials are a seasonal tradition, airing each August and drawing audiences with fresh anthology horror tales.
When was this horror special released in Japan?
The special aired on August 20, 2022, in Japan. Like its predecessors, it was timed to coincide with the summer season — a period deeply associated with ghost stories and supernatural folklore in Japanese culture, making it a fitting seasonal tradition.
